VIDEO Figure Skating on Top of the World

Living her light skating on top of a mountain’s frozen lake, Elizabeth takes my breath away! Growing up near the Canadian Rockies, I know the feeling of being on the mountain-tops of Alberta and BC where Nature and the forces of the Elements loom large. At times it made me feel both small and at other times powerful. To be in the magic of natures’ reality is something I will never forget and often aspire to feel again.

Error! You must specify a value for the Video ID, Width, Height parameters to use this shortcode!